技术文摘
掌握!Python 实现数据预测集成工具制作
掌握!Python 实现数据预测集成工具制作
在当今数据驱动的时代,数据预测对于企业和组织的决策制定至关重要。Python 作为一种强大的编程语言,为我们提供了丰富的库和工具,使实现数据预测集成工具成为可能。
我们需要明确数据预测的目标和问题。是预测销售额的增长趋势,还是预测用户的行为模式?根据不同的目标,选择合适的数据来源和特征工程方法。
数据收集是第一步。这可能涉及从数据库中提取数据、爬取网页数据,或者读取本地的 CSV 文件。在获取数据后,对其进行清洗和预处理,处理缺失值、异常值,并将数据进行标准化或归一化,以确保模型能够有效地学习。
接下来,选择合适的预测模型。常见的有线性回归、决策树、随机森林、支持向量机等。Python 中的 scikit-learn 库提供了这些模型的便捷实现。我们可以通过交叉验证等技术来评估不同模型的性能,并选择最优的模型。
在模型训练过程中,调整参数以获得更好的预测效果。例如,对于决策树,可以调整树的深度;对于随机森林,可以调整树的数量。监控模型的训练过程,观察损失函数的变化情况。
集成多种模型也是提高预测准确性的有效方法。可以使用 Ensemble 方法,如 Adaboost 、 GradientBoosting 等,将多个弱学习器组合成一个强学习器。
为了使工具更具实用性,我们需要将模型进行封装,并提供友好的用户界面。可以使用 Flask 或 Django 框架创建 Web 应用,或者使用 Tkinter 库创建桌面应用,让用户能够方便地输入数据并获取预测结果。
在工具完成后,进行充分的测试和验证。使用新的数据集对工具进行测试,确保其预测的准确性和稳定性。
通过 Python 实现数据预测集成工具制作,不仅能够提升我们的数据处理和分析能力,还能为企业和组织提供有价值的决策支持。不断探索和优化,让我们在数据预测的道路上越走越远。
TAGS: Python 数据预测 Python 制作 数据预测集成 掌握工具制作